Two-dimensional echocardiography in acute transmural and non-transmural myocardial infarction.

Abstract

Left ventricular wall motion abnormalities in acute myocardial infarction and their changes during hospitalisation were investigated in 40 patients by means of two-dimensional echocardiography (2-D-E). It was confirmed that two-dimensional echocardiography can detect segmental left ventricular asynergy, follow up its development during hospitalisation and provide on the basis of this information on the extent of infarction. Differences were found between transmural and non-transmural infarctions, in particular as regards the duration of impaired wall motion (in non-transmural infarctions it was only temporary). Suggested indicators of the extent of this disorder ("index of asynergy" and "extent of asynergy") seem to be valuable for the evaluation of the extent of infarction and of its clinical impact. The sensitivity and specificity of echocardiography, as compared with postmortem findings, is satisfactory.
